Why Vienna is strong for seafood

  1. Central European logistics — Adriatic and Atlantic catch reach the capital daily.
  2. Alpine freshwater tradition — trout and local lake fish alongside shellfish.
  3. Café-to-fine-dining range — casual fish houses next to hotel tasting rooms.

What to eat in Vienna

  • Forelle (trout) — grilled, meunière, or almond-crusted.
  • Oysters — raw bars with French and European selections.
  • Wiener Schnitzel alternatives — look for fish schnitzel when listed.
  • Seafood pasta and risotto — strong Italian-Austrian crossover.
  • Smoked fish plates — local and Nordic-style starters.
  • Catch of the day — ask species and origin.

How to choose a fish restaurant

  1. Catch of the day named clearly — not just “white fish.”
  2. Transparent pricing for lobster, shrimp platters, and whole fish by weight.
  3. Busy local lunch or dinner beats empty early tourist rooms.
  4. Short seafood-led menus over endless international lists.

Practical tips (2026)

Reserve Friday–Saturday in the centre. Lunch set menus often beat dinner spend. Ask whether fish is Adriatic, Atlantic, or local freshwater.
